在腾讯云部署应用时,选择稳定性最好的Linux系统主要取决于你的具体应用场景、团队熟悉程度以及对长期支持(LTS)和安全更新的需求。以下是几个在腾讯云上广泛使用且稳定性表现优异的Linux发行版推荐:
1. CentOS Stream / Rocky Linux / AlmaLinux(RHEL系)
- 特点:
- 基于Red Hat Enterprise Linux(RHEL),企业级稳定性和长期支持。
- 软件包管理使用
yum或dnf,适合生产环境。 - 社区活跃,安全性高,适合中大型企业应用。
- 推荐版本:
- Rocky Linux 8.x / 9.x 或 AlmaLinux 8/9:作为CentOS停更后的主流替代品,完全兼容RHEL,提供长期支持(通常10年)。
- 适用场景:Web服务器、数据库、企业级中间件、X_X类应用。
⚠️ 注意:原 CentOS Linux 已停止维护,建议避免使用旧版 CentOS 7 及以下。
2. Ubuntu LTS(长期支持版)
- 特点:
- 更新频繁但LTS版本(如20.04、22.04)提供5年支持。
- 软件生态丰富,社区强大,适合开发者和云原生应用。
- 与Docker、Kubernetes等现代技术栈集成良好。
- 推荐版本:
- Ubuntu Server 22.04 LTS 或 20.04 LTS(如果应用依赖较老软件包)。
- 适用场景:Web应用、容器化部署、AI/ML、DevOps环境。
3. Debian Stable
- 特点:
- 极其注重稳定性和可靠性,软件版本较保守。
- 适合对系统稳定性要求极高、不追求最新功能的场景。
- 资源占用低,适合轻量级或老旧硬件。
- 推荐版本:
- Debian 11(Bullseye) 或 Debian 12(Bookworm)。
- 适用场景:静态网站、DNS服务器、嵌入式或边缘计算节点。
综合对比与建议:
| 系统 | 稳定性 | 易用性 | 软件新旧 | 推荐指数 |
|---|---|---|---|---|
| Rocky Linux / AlmaLinux | ⭐⭐⭐⭐⭐ | ⭐⭐⭐⭐ | 较保守 | ⭐⭐⭐⭐⭐ |
| Ubuntu 22.04 LTS | ⭐⭐⭐⭐☆ | ⭐⭐⭐⭐⭐ | 较新 | ⭐⭐⭐⭐☆ |
| Debian Stable | ⭐⭐⭐⭐⭐ | ⭐⭐⭐ | 保守 | ⭐⭐⭐⭐ |
结论:
✅ 如果追求极致稳定和企业级支持:推荐 Rocky Linux 9 或 AlmaLinux 9(RHEL系)。
✅ 如果兼顾开发效率和生态:推荐 Ubuntu 22.04 LTS,尤其适合云原生和容器环境。
✅ 如果运行关键服务且无需频繁更新软件:可选 Debian 12。
腾讯云操作建议:
- 在腾讯云控制台创建CVM实例时,直接选择官方镜像(如“Rocky Linux”、“Ubuntu Server LTS”)以确保安全性和兼容性。
- 启用自动安全更新,并结合云监控、告警服务提升整体稳定性。
如有特定应用(如MySQL、Nginx、K8s等),也可根据官方推荐选择对应系统。
云计算